STUTTGART: Starting mid-March 2025, Mercedes-Benz will bundle digital functions for public charging under MB.Charge Public , replacing the previous service Mercedes me Charge.
Mercedes-Benz is the first car manufacturer to introduce an integrated reservation function for charging stations.
Starting in Germany and the United States, Mercedes-Benz customers can exclusively reserve a charging point in advance at one of Mercedes-Benz’s own charging parks via MB.Charge Public.
With active route guidance through Navigation with Electric Intelligence, the reservation is automatically made by the vehicle 15 minutes before reaching the charging station.
The reservation function saves drivers waiting times and ensures that a charging spot is kept available for them.

MB.Charge Public will bundle digital functions for public charging and offer extended features to make charging even more convenient.
Charging prices and tariffs will remain unchanged under MB.Charge Public compared to before.
Existing Mercedes me Charge contracts will automatically be switched to the same tariff in MB.Charge Public.
Current Mercedes me Charge RFID charging cards will remain valid and functional. MB.Charge Public is available for all electric cars and vans from Mercedes-Benz as well as for plug-in hybrids.
In addition to private customers, business and fleet customers will also benefit from the convenient public charging service.

Customer benefits of MB.Charge Public:
- One of the world's largest charging networks: With over 2.3 million charging points from more than 1,600 charging station operators, customers have easy access to one of the largest charging networks in the world through MB.Charge Public.
- Charging station display and intelligent route planning: The exact location and current availability of charging points are displayed via MBUX navigation, for example, in the vicinity or at the destination.
Navigation with Electric Intelligence plans the fastest and most comfortable route including charging stops based on numerous factors.
- Easy charging start: With a charging contract at MB.Charge Public, customers always charge in the usual user-friendly way, regardless of the respective charging station operator.
Authentication at the charging station is done via the MBUX multimedia system, the Mercedes-Benz app, the RFID charging card, or directly via Plug & Charge at participating charging point operators.
- Transparent costs: Before charging, the exact prices per kilowatt-hour or minute, as well as the estimated costs to reach the maximum charge level for fully electric vehicles, are displayed.
Each charging process is automatically billed through MB.Charge Public.
